How We Work
1
Emergency Contact
Your urgent call initiates our rapid response. We gather critical information, assess the water damage over the phone, and dispatch a certified team to your Sugar Land location immediately to prevent further damage.
2
On-Site Assessment
Upon arrival, our technicians use moisture meters and thermal imaging to accurately map the extent of water intrusion. This detailed inspection informs our comprehensive drying plan and prepares for water extraction.
3
Water Extraction & Drying
High-powered pumps and industrial-grade extractors remove standing water. We then strategically place dehumidifiers and air movers to thoroughly dry affected areas, preventing mold growth and preparing for restoration.
4
Cleaning & Sanitizing
Contaminated materials are safely removed. We apply antimicrobial treatments to sanitize all surfaces, ensuring a clean and healthy environment. This step ensures readiness for structural repairs and reconstruction.
5
Restoration & Final Walkthrough
Our skilled craftsmen repair or replace damaged building materials, restoring your property to its pre-damage condition. A final walkthrough ensures your complete satisfaction with our work and the restored space.

Retail Store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) Yes No You can likely clean up the spill yourself with a mop and towels.
Large water spill (over 1 gallon) No Yes You'll need specialized equipment to extract the water and prevent further damage.
Standing water in a large area No Yes You'll need professional equipment to extract the water and prevent further damage.
Mold growth No Yes Mold can be a serious health hazard and needs professional cleanup and removal.
Water damage to electrical systems or equipment No Yes You'll need a professional to assess and repair any damage to electrical systems or equipment.

Retail Store Water Damage Restoration Cost In Huntsville, TX

The cost of retail store water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of your store, and local conditions in the Huntsville, TX area. Our estimates are based on the following factors: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 - $2,500 The amount of water extracted and the equipment needed to do so.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of equipment needed to dry out the space.
Cleaning and disinfection $500 - $2,000 The amount of cleaning and disinfection required to remove dirt and bacteria.
Restoration and reconstruction $2,000 - $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ed to repair or replace affected areas.
